Peter Rubin Obituary

Peter Karlsson Rubin
April 24, 1985 - January 29, 2022
Peter Karlsson Rubin, 36, of Berkeley and Santa Cruz, died January 29, 2022 in Capitola, California. Brilliant, creative, and compassionate, he made an enormous difference in the lives of hundreds of people.

Peter was born in Berkeley on April 24, 1985, and attended the Head-Royce School in Oakland, where he was co-valedictorian of his high school class, and Stanford University, where he earned a B.S. and an M.S. in Mechanical Engineering, specializing in Product Design, and received a Terman Award for being in the top 5% of his engineering class.

After college and travels through Southeast Asia, Peter spent three years as a product designer at Daylight Design in San Francisco, while teaching Team Dynamics at the Stanford School of Design. He left in 2011 to begin a series of new, overlapping careers, principally working as a business and personal coach, but also co-founding the Brotherhood Community, creating workshops on racism, social justice, masculinity, relationships, and other issues that mattered to him; writing weekly newsletters to his hundreds of followers; and leading guided meditations for various groups, including his men's groups and his women of color meditation group.

Peter brought radiant joy wherever he went and rejoiced in the beauty of nature. He was a creative force, with his oil paintings and watercolors, his piano improvisations, and his spiritual –and spirited – drumming and flute-playing. Peter was insatiably curious, fascinated by how things work, how to make them work better, and how to help people truly thrive. Most important to Peter were his close relationships with family, friends, colleagues and clients. He had a talent for connecting with people at a deep level and developing open and honest interpersonal communication. He shared his feelings and beliefs with courageous authenticity and vulnerability. He cherished personal interactions, which he nurtured through joy, insight, and his probing intellect.

His family and friends will miss him tremendously and will hold him in their hearts forever.

Peter's survivors include his parents, Michael Rubin and Andrea Peterson of Berkeley, his brother, Eric, and Eric's wife, Avry Schellenbach, of Oakland, his sister, Emily, and Emily's fiancé, Ryan Gilley, of Oakland. A memorial service will be held in the East Bay later this spring.

The family suggests that donations in memory of Peter be made to Spirit Rock Meditation Center to honor Peter's commitment to meditation, or to RMI (formerly the Rocky Mountain Institute), which Peter supported because of its work on climate change.
